2bribe verb
bribes; bribed; brib·ing [+ obj] : to try to get someone to do something by giving or promising something valuable (such as money) : to give or offer a bribe to (someone)
▪ She was arrested for attempting to bribe a judge. ▪ They bribed him to keep quiet about the incident. ▪ We bribed the children with candy.
